What Modified Wood Feels Like in Real Use
The first thing you notice is its consistency. Boards arrive straight, smooth, and surprisingly uniform. When you run your hand across the surface, there’s a subtle density that hints at its enhanced structure. Unlike untreated wood, which can vary widely from board to board, modified wood carries a sense of reliability. It cuts cleanly, holds fasteners without splintering, and stays true to its shape even after exposure to moisture or sunlight.

This tactile stability is one of the reasons many builders prefer it over composites. Composites may be durable, but they often lack the organic warmth that makes wood emotionally appealing. Modified wood preserves that natural charm while solving many of the headaches that come with traditional timber. Key Features That Define Modified Wood
Dimensional Stability — Modified wood resists warping, swelling, and shrinking. This is especially noticeable in climates with dramatic seasonal changes.

Moisture Resistance — The modification process reduces the wood’s ability to absorb water, making it ideal for decks, siding, and outdoor structures.

Durability Against Rot and Insects — Modified wood stands up to decay far better than untreated wood.

Low Maintenance — It ages gracefully, often developing a silver‑gray patina that many homeowners find elegant.

Sustainability — Most modified wood products use fast‑growing species and avoid harsh chemicals, making them environmentally responsible.

A Personal Evaluation: How It Performs Over Time
In my view, the most impressive aspect of modified wood is how it behaves over time. A deck built with modified wood doesn’t twist after a rainy season. Siding stays flat and clean‑lined without constant repainting. Even small projects like planter boxes or outdoor benches maintain their shape and finish far longer than expected.

Another detail I appreciate is how it ages. Some materials look tired after a few years outdoors, but modified wood develops character. The patina feels intentional, almost like the material is settling into its environment rather than deteriorating. For those who prefer a richer tone, a simple oil treatment keeps the original color vibrant. The flexibility to choose between natural aging and maintained color adds to its appeal.

Noise and vibration control also benefit from its stability. When installed as flooring or interior paneling, modified wood feels solid underfoot, with fewer creaks and shifts compared to traditional timber.

Who Benefits Most from Modified Wood
Homeowners
People building decks, pergolas, fences, or siding often choose modified wood for its long‑term reliability. It’s ideal for families who want outdoor spaces that stay beautiful without constant upkeep.

Designers and Architects
Professionals appreciate its stability and predictable behavior. Tight tolerances, clean lines, and modern aesthetics are easier to achieve when the material doesn’t warp or shift.

DIY Enthusiasts
Modified wood is forgiving. It cuts smoothly, stays straight, and doesn’t surprise you with sudden splits. For weekend builders, this reduces frustration and improves project outcomes.
